NZ: Trade deficit likely to narrow – TDS

The research team at TD Securities expect the New Zealand’s trade deficit to narrow a little to -$NZ1.3b (mkt -$NZ1.365b).

Key Quotes

“As a seasonal pickup in exports to $NZ4.3b offsets the bulging import bill of $NZ5.6b via higher imported fuel costs (oil and lower NZD).”
